Charging bin capable of preventing earphone from falling off
By incorporating a transmission component with limiting blocks and locking blocks inside the Bluetooth earphone charging case, and utilizing a spring mechanism to secure the Bluetooth earphones, the problem of Bluetooth earphones shaking and falling out of the charging case is solved, thus improving protection.

TECHNICAL FIELD
[0001] The utility model relates to the technical field of bluetooth headset, especially to a charging bin capable of preventing earphone from falling off. BACKGROUND
[0002] The bluetooth headset charging bin is a portable charging device of the bluetooth headset, and its main function is to provide additional power support for the bluetooth headset. Through the charging bin, the bluetooth headset can be charged at any time, and the charging bin also has a storage function, so it is widely used. The existing structure of the bluetooth headset charging bin comprises a shell, a charging assembly and an indicator lamp. The bluetooth headset is placed on the charging bin. However, there is no fixing structure. When the top cover of the bluetooth headset charging bin is opened, the bluetooth headset is prone to shaking. In addition, the bluetooth headset is small and difficult to take. The existing bluetooth headset charging bin is prone to causing the bluetooth headset to fall off, so the protection of the bluetooth headset is poor. SUMMARY
[0003] The utility model solves the problems of shaking and falling of the bluetooth headset.
[0004] In order to solve the above technical problems, the utility model provides a charging bin capable of preventing earphone from falling off, which comprises a charging bin shell, two accommodating grooves for placing the bluetooth headset are arranged in the charging bin shell, a limiting block and a clamping block are arranged on the top of the charging bin shell and symmetrically about the middle part of the accommodating groove, a clamping plate is slidably arranged on the limiting block, a clamping groove is formed in the side close to the limiting block of the clamping block, the side of the clamping plate is abutted with the inside of the clamping groove through a spring, a pressing plate is arranged on the two sides of the charging bin shell, one end of the pressing plate is connected with a transmission assembly arranged in the charging bin shell in the direction perpendicular to the side surface of the charging bin shell, the transmission assembly is in transmission connection with the clamping plate to drive the clamping plate to move between the clamping groove and the limiting block, and a charging assembly for connecting the bluetooth headset is arranged in the accommodating groove.
[0005] Preferably, the transmission assembly is composed of a first rack, a gear, a second rack and a spring. The middle part of the gear is rotatably connected to the inside of the charging bin shell, and is in meshing transmission connection with the first rack and the second rack at the same time. The first rack is slidably arranged in the charging bin shell, and one end of the first rack is connected with the pressing plate. The second rack is mounted on the bottom of the clamping plate and is slidably connected to the inside of the charging bin shell. The side of the clamping plate away from the accommodating groove is mounted on the inner wall of the charging bin shell through a spring.
[0006] Preferably, the side surface of the charging bin shell is symmetrically provided with sliding holes, and the two sliding holes correspond to the length direction of the clamping plate. The pressing plate is slidably arranged in the sliding hole.
[0007] Preferably, the two sides of the top of the limiting block are provided with upward extending baffles, the two sides of the clamping plate are between the two baffles, the bottom of the clamping plate is vertically connected with the communication hole and enters the inside of the charging compartment shell through the communication hole.
[0008] Preferably, the first rack is slidably connected with the limiting guide rail arranged in the inside of the charging compartment shell in the length direction.
[0009] Preferably, the top of the charging compartment shell is rotationally connected with a top cover for closing the upper end of the charging compartment shell through a hinge.
[0010] Preferably, the outer surface of the pressing plate is provided with anti-skid strips.
[0011] Preferably, the front of the charging compartment shell is provided with an indicator lamp.
[0012] Preferably, the front of the charging compartment shell is further provided with a USB charging jack.
[0013] Preferably, the bottom of the clamping plate is not lower than the height of the Bluetooth earphone when the Bluetooth earphone is placed in the accommodating groove.
[0014] Compared with the prior art, the charging compartment capable of preventing earphone from falling off has the following beneficial effects:
[0015] 1、The pressing plate, transmission assembly, spring, limiting block, clamping plate and clamping groove are arranged, when the Bluetooth earphone is placed, the pressing plate is pushed into the inside of the charging compartment shell, the pressing plate drives the transmission assembly to move, the transmission assembly drives the clamping plate to slide on the limiting block, so that the clamping plate slides from the clamping groove to the limiting block, thereby removing the block above the accommodating groove, and the spring generates elastic force, then the Bluetooth earphone is grabbed and placed into the accommodating groove, so that the Bluetooth earphone is connected with the charging assembly, the pressing plate is loosened, the clamping plate is driven by the elastic force of the spring, so that the clamping plate abuts against the clamping groove, thereby blocking the Bluetooth earphone from falling off from the accommodating groove, the clamping plate is above the Bluetooth earphone, can block the Bluetooth earphone from shaking and falling off, compared with the prior art, the protectiveness of the Bluetooth earphone is improved, and the problem that the Bluetooth earphone is prone to shake and fall off is solved. DETAILED DESCRIPTION
[0021] The utility model relates to a kind of charging bin that can prevent earphone from falling, as shown in Figures 1-4 Limiting block 3 is symmetrically arranged on the top of charging bin shell 1 about the middle part of containing groove 2, and clamping block 4 is arranged on the position of limiting block 3, clamping plate 5 is slidably arranged on limiting block 3, clamping groove 6 is formed in the side of clamping block 4 close to limiting block 3, spring 84 is arranged on the side of clamping plate 5 and abuts with the inside of clamping groove 6, pressing plate 7 is arranged on the both sides of charging bin shell 1, one end of pressing plate 7 is connected with transmission assembly 8 arranged in the inside of charging bin shell 1 in the direction perpendicular to the side of charging bin shell 1, transmission assembly 8 is drivingly connected with clamping plate 5, to drive clamping plate 5 to move between clamping groove 6 and limiting block 3, containing groove 2 is provided with charging assembly for connecting Bluetooth earphone, by setting charging bin shell 1 as the main body of charging bin, when placing Bluetooth earphone, pushing pressing plate 7 into the inside of charging bin shell 1, pressing plate 7 drives transmission assembly 8 to move, transmission assembly 8 drives clamping plate 5 to slide on limiting block 3, so that clamping plate 5 slides from clamping groove 6 to limiting block 3, to remove the block above containing groove 2, and spring 84 generates elastic force, then Bluetooth earphone is placed into containing groove 2, so that Bluetooth earphone is connected with charging assembly, releasing pressing plate 7, clamping plate 5 is abutted with clamping groove 6 by the elastic force of spring 84, so as to block Bluetooth earphone from falling from containing groove 2, clamping plate 5 is above Bluetooth earphone, can block Bluetooth earphone from shaking and falling, compared with prior art, improve the protection of Bluetooth earphone, solve the problem that Bluetooth earphone is easy to shake and fall.
[0022] In this embodiment of the invention, the transmission assembly 8 consists of a first rack 81, a gear 82, a second rack 83, and a spring 84. The gear 82 is rotatably connected to the inside of the charging housing 1 at its center and simultaneously meshes with the first rack 81 and the second rack 83 for transmission. The first rack 81 is slidably disposed inside the charging housing 1, and one end of the first rack 81 is connected to the pressing plate 7. The second rack 83 is installed at the bottom of the locking plate 5 and slidably connected to the inside of the charging housing 1. The side of the locking plate 5 away from the receiving groove 2 is connected to the charging housing 1 by the spring 84. The inner wall is installed by setting a first rack 81, a gear 82, a second rack 83, and a spring 84. Pushing the pressing plate 7 causes the first rack 81 to slide. The first rack 81 meshes with the gear 82, causing the gear 82 to rotate. The gear 82 causes the second rack 83 to slide. The second rack 83 causes the locking plate 5 to move on the limiting block 3. When the locking plate 5 moves towards the limiting block 3, the spring 84 is compressed, generating elastic force. After the pressing plate 7 is released, the elastic force acts on the locking plate 5, causing the locking plate 5 to abut against the inside of the locking groove 6.
[0023] In an embodiment of this utility model, the side of the charging case housing 1 is symmetrically provided with sliding holes 9. The two sliding holes 9 are corresponding in the length direction of the locking plate 5. The pressing plate 7 is slidably disposed inside the sliding holes 9. By providing the sliding holes 9, the stability of the sliding between the pressing plate 7 and the charging case housing 1 is improved.
[0024] In this embodiment of the utility model, the top two sides of the limiting block 3 are provided with upwardly extending baffles 10, the two sides of the locking plate 5 are located between the two baffles 10, and the bottom of the limiting block 3 is provided with a connecting hole 11 that communicates with the inside of the charging compartment housing 1. The bottom of the locking plate 5 is engaged with the connecting hole 11 in the vertical direction and passes through the connecting hole 11 to enter the inside of the charging compartment housing 1. By setting the baffles 10 and the connecting hole 11, the baffles 10 limit the locking plate 5 from the top two sides of the limiting block 3, thereby improving the stability of the locking plate 5 when sliding, and it passes through the connecting hole 11 to enter the inside of the charging compartment housing 1.
[0025] In an embodiment of this utility model, the first rack 81 is slidably connected to the limiting guide rail 12 disposed inside the charging case housing 1 in its length direction. By setting the limiting guide rail 12, the limiting guide rail 12 limits the first rack 81, thereby improving the stability of the sliding of the first rack 81.
[0026] In an embodiment of this utility model, the top of the charging case housing 1 is rotatably connected by a hinge to a top cover 13 for sealing the upper end of the charging case housing 1. By setting the top cover 13, the top cover 13 rotates on the upper end of the charging case housing 1, thereby improving the protection of the charging case housing 1 by covering the upper end of the charging case housing 1.
[0027] In an embodiment of this utility model, an anti-slip strip 14 is provided on the outer surface of the pressing plate 7. By providing the anti-slip strip 14, the friction force on the surface of the pressing plate 7 is increased, making it easier to push the pressing plate 7.
[0028] In an embodiment of this utility model, an indicator light 15 is provided on the front of the charging case housing 1. By providing the indicator light 15, the remaining power of the charging case can be displayed, making it easy for the user to monitor the power status.
[0029] In an embodiment of this utility model, a USB charging port 16 is also provided on the front of the charging case housing 1. By providing the USB charging port 16, the USB charging port 16 can be connected to an external power source, making it convenient to charge the charging case.
[0030] In this embodiment of the invention, the bottom of the locking plate 9 is not lower than the height of the Bluetooth headset when it is placed inside the receiving slot 2. By setting the above structure, it is ensured that when the Bluetooth headset is inside the receiving slot 2, the locking plate 5 is above the Bluetooth headset.
[0031] In use, first, rotate the top cover 13 to the top of the charging case housing 1, then hold the pressing plates 7 on both sides and press them towards the charging case housing 1. The pressing plates 7 drive the first rack 81 to slide on the limiting guide rail 12 through the sliding holes 9. The first rack 81 and the second rack 83 are engaged with the gear 82. The first rack 81 drives the gear 82 to rotate, thereby the gear 82 drives the second rack 83 to move. The second rack 83 drives the locking plate 5 to move on the limiting block 3, and the locking plate 5 moves towards the limiting block 3. When the spring 84 is compressed, it generates elastic force. At this time, the locking plate 5 moves onto the limiting block 3, maintaining the state of pressing the pressing plate 7. Simultaneously, the Bluetooth headset is placed into the receiving slot 2, and the Bluetooth headset is connected to the charging component. When the pressing plate 7 is released, the elastic force of the spring 84 acts on the locking plate 5, causing one end of the locking plate 5 to move into the locking slot 6. At this time, the locking plate 5 is above the Bluetooth headset and is connected to an external power source through the USB charging port 16 to charge the charging case. The remaining power is displayed by the indicator light 15.
